Baby’s Big World™ introduces children to important concepts using simple text and delightful art. Discover the wonders of CHEMISTRY, from the periodic table to how compounds are made.

This book is cute, colorful, and educational, and I think that the metaphor comparing the Periodic Table to a crayon box is a creative way to help children grasp the concept. However, this book's ending was very abrupt, and it needed another page with some kind of conclusion.

I am a chemist myself so I appreciated the elements as crayons metaphor. I feel like this book is one of the best ones I've seen at making a complex subject such as chemistry more approachable for a 2-year-old.
